In the case of Brandon Lee, the stray bullet in the barrel was due to a "squib" load, a cartridge with no powder or insufficient powder, that propels the bullet out of the case and into the barrel, but with so little energy it stays stuck there.

On the set of The Crow, they wanted cartridges that look realistic (a blank has a crimp at the front of the cartridge instead of a bullet).

Instead of using specially made dummy ammunition, they took actual cartridges, removed the bullet to empty the powder, and then put the bullet back in place.

The problem is they did not remove the primer, so when somebody tested the gun with the "dummy" ammunition, when the trigger was pulled the firing pin hit the primer, which exploded, and it created just enough energy to propel the bullet in the barrel.

When they later shot a blank through the same gun, the expanding gaz from the blank propelled the stuck bullet out of barrel and fatally struck Brandon
